    What is a Sauna?

    A sauna is a small room designed to be heated for relaxation and health benefits. Traditionally, saunas operate at temperatures between 150°F and 195°F (65°C to 90°C), making them an excellent way to unwind while enjoying various health advantages, such as improved cardiovascular health, detoxification, and stress relief.

    The Benefits of Using a Sauna

    • Relaxation: Saunas promote relaxation by improving circulation and relieving muscle tension.
    • Detoxification: Sweating is one of the body’s natural ways to eliminate toxins.
    • Improved Sleep: Regular sauna use can help improve sleep patterns and quality.
    • Cardiovascular Health: Some studies suggest that regular sauna use may lower the risk of heart disease.

    Infrared Saunas

    Infrared saunas use infrared heaters to emit radiant heat, which is absorbed directly by the skin. This method operates at lower temperatures and is generally more tolerable for those who may find traditional saunas too intense. Some local options include:

    Comparison of Sauna Types in West Palm Beach

    Sauna Type Temperature Range Humidity Level Health Benefits
    Traditional Finnish Sauna 150°F – 195°F Low Detoxification, relaxation, cardiovascular improvement
    Infrared Sauna 100°F – 150°F Low Muscle relief, detoxification, weight loss
    Steam Room 110°F – 120°F High Respiratory benefits, skin hydration, muscle relaxation

    Tips for a Great Sauna Experience

    • Hydrate: Always drink plenty of water before and after your sauna session.
    • Time Your Visits: Limit your sauna sessions to 15-20 minutes at a time, especially in high heat.
    • Listen to Your Body: If you feel dizzy or uncomfortable, it’s essential to exit the sauna immediately.
    • Cool Down: Allow your body to cool down gradually after exiting.

    Pros and Cons of Different Sauna Experiences

    Sauna Experience Pros Cons
    Traditional Finnish Sauna High heat; good for detox; social atmosphere Can be too hot for some; requires acclimatization
    Infrared Sauna Lower temperatures; private experience; targeted relief Less traditional; may not provide the same social experience
    Steam Room Great for skin; helps with respiratory issues Can feel claustrophobic; humidity may be uncomfortable for some

    What is the best time to use a sauna?

    The best time to use a sauna is after a workout or at the end of the day to help relax your body and mind.

    Can I use a sauna every day?

    Using a sauna daily is generally safe for most people; however, it’s essential to listen to your body and not overdo it.

    How long should I stay in a sauna?

    A typical sauna session lasts between 15 to 20 minutes. Beginners may start with shorter sessions and gradually increase the duration.
